Skip to content

Commit 8ca2e00

Browse files
committed
Test component audit event diff checks to use WebTestHelper.getRemoteApiConnection(false) in AuditLogHelper
- then we don't have to separately deal with the impersonated user as we just use a separate remote API connection
1 parent a263af8 commit 8ca2e00

2 files changed

Lines changed: 4 additions & 2 deletions

File tree

src/org/labkey/test/components/ui/entities/EntityBulkUpdateDialog.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@
44
import org.labkey.test.BootstrapLocators;
55
import org.labkey.test.Locator;
66
import org.labkey.test.WebDriverWrapper;
7+
import org.labkey.test.WebTestHelper;
78
import org.labkey.test.components.Component;
89
import org.labkey.test.components.UpdatingComponent;
910
import org.labkey.test.components.bootstrap.ModalDialog;
@@ -290,7 +291,7 @@ public void clickUpdate(boolean skipAuditEventCheck)
290291
});
291292

292293
// check for the expected number of Data Changes in the latest audit event records
293-
AuditLogHelper auditLogHelper = new AuditLogHelper(getWrapper());
294+
AuditLogHelper auditLogHelper = new AuditLogHelper(getWrapper(), () -> WebTestHelper.getRemoteApiConnection(false));
294295
String auditEventName = auditLogHelper.getAuditEventNameFromURL();
295296
if (!skipAuditEventCheck && auditEventName != null)
296297
{

src/org/labkey/test/components/ui/grids/DetailTableEdit.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@
55
import org.labkey.test.BootstrapLocators;
66
import org.labkey.test.Locator;
77
import org.labkey.test.WebDriverWrapper;
8+
import org.labkey.test.WebTestHelper;
89
import org.labkey.test.components.Component;
910
import org.labkey.test.components.WebDriverComponent;
1011
import org.labkey.test.components.html.Checkbox;
@@ -515,7 +516,7 @@ public DetailDataPanel clickSave(boolean skipAuditEventCheck)
515516
.until(ExpectedConditions.stalenessOf(elementCache().saveButton));
516517

517518
// check for the expected number of Data Changes in the latest audit event records
518-
AuditLogHelper auditLogHelper = new AuditLogHelper(getWrapper());
519+
AuditLogHelper auditLogHelper = new AuditLogHelper(getWrapper(), () -> WebTestHelper.getRemoteApiConnection(false));
519520
String auditEventName = auditLogHelper.getAuditEventNameFromURL();
520521
if (!skipAuditEventCheck && auditEventName != null)
521522
{

0 commit comments

Comments
 (0)